Now this I say lest anyone should deceive you with persuasive words. For though I am absent in the flesh, yet I am with you in spirit, rejoicing to see your good order and the steadfastness of your faith in Christ (Colossians 2: 4 -5)
The new Christians in Colosse were doing well but were also having serious problems. And their main problem was people who wanted to talk them off the faith in Christ. These people were the Jews who followed Judaism, and they come with persuasive words, arguments and speech that sound reasonable and plausible but were not based on truth and the whole counsel of the scriptures. Thus they misled people and turned them away from the faith in Christ.
And Paul, after receiving the news from Missioner Epaphras, wanted to prevent that. So he reminded these new Christians of what they should watch out for.
The gospel they have received has produced in them, which should also produce in us, and in anyone who is receiving the true gospel teachings:
- a good order - in other words, a good orderly life. The Weymouth translation puts it this way: a good discipline life. These Gentiles and Jewish converts began to have a life that was orderly, discipline and godly, uncommon in their time, and all as a result of the fruit produced from good teachings of the gospel of Christ.
- steadfastness of faith - in other words, the solid faith, or firmness of faith in Christ, which was rooted in the finished works of Christ on the cross.
And Paul said, he rejoiced to see or witness that among these new Christians.
